#e13c3d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e13c3d is composed of 88.2% red, 23.5% green and 23.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 73.3% magenta, 72.9%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 359.6 degrees, a saturation of 73.3% and a lightness of 55.9%. #e13c3d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ff787a with #c30000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

Shades and Tints of #e13c3d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090101 is the darkest color, while #fef7f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e13c3d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#938a8a is the less saturated color, while #fb2223 is the most saturated one.
